The New South Wales State Emergency Service has issued a number of evacuation orders for parts of Sydney, on Sunday evening, as the city faces its heaviest rains in more than two-decades.
An evacuation order was issued for residents in parts of Narrabeen, Moorebank, Chipping Norton and Milperra within the city. More than 100,000 people are without power across the state.
Emergency services in NSW are also warning of worsening conditions and further evacuations, as heavy rain lashes coastal areas. Multiple flood warnings are in place from the South Coast up to Queensland, which is also experiencing wild weather. Image: Getty
